Just Got a SEGA Saturn? Play These 10 Games First!

Of all the systems SEGA released, none has had a redemption arc quite like the SEGA Saturn. For years it was the odd one out – misunderstood, overlooked, or just plain ignored by most gamers outside of Japan. But lately? That story has been changing.

More and more gamers – collectors, retro fans, and curious newcomers – are finally giving the Saturn a chance. Whether they missed it first time, or just wrote it off in favour of the PlayStation and/or Nintendo 64, they’re now picking up the console for the very first time … and discovering just why so many of us loved it back in the day, and still love it now.

So if you’re one of those people who has recently come to Saturn – or you’re thinking about picking one up – welcome to the club! In our brand new video, I chose 10 games to kick off your journey and show you exactly why our favourite game system has earned your long-overdue respect.

Putting this list together wasn’t easy. There are plenty of games I personally love that didn’t make the cut – but this was never about my favourites.

Instead, I focused on presenting a balanced mix of genres and experiences that I think any first-time Saturn owner should try, because a list based purely on nostalgia or personal bias wouldn’t do the system – or you – any favours. 

We’ve got 3D fighters, arcade racers, RPG’s, and action galore … so join us at the SEGAGuys for the 10 games every new SEGA Saturn should play.
